This study aims to determine whether the morphology of the wing venation can be used for the classification within the genus &lt;em&gt;Antheraea&lt;/em&gt;. Toxopeus (1940) already noted that the venation of the highly variable &lt;em&gt;Antheraea &lt;/em&gt;taxa may be a tool for determination because he found that the vein R1 [named R1+2 in this contribution] branch off from the stalk differently. The venation of six taxa was illustrated graphically by Toxopeus (1940). Further examples, Dicky, Erick, Kokko, Barron, Schaalje &amp;amp; Gowen (1992) used image analysis of wings for the identification of ichneumonid wasps (Hymenoptera: Ichneumonidae), Albrecht &amp;amp; Kalia (1997) noted a variation of wing venation in Elachistidae (Lepidoptera: Gelechioidea), Nath &amp;amp; Devi (2009) studied the venation pattern and shape variation in &lt;em&gt;A&lt;/em&gt;. (&lt;em&gt;Ao&lt;/em&gt;.) &lt;em&gt;assamensis &lt;/em&gt;(Helfer, 1837) of Assam, India, Warren (1936) demonstrated that the wing venation varies considerably and may even display an asymmetric pattern in &lt;em&gt;Erebia &lt;/em&gt;sp. (Lepidoptera: Nymphalidae), and Sotavolta (1994) recorded a considerable intraspecific variation in the wing venation of Arctiidae (Lepidoptera). Detailed studies on the variation of wing venation in &lt;em&gt;Antheraea &lt;/em&gt;are lacking so far.&lt;br /&gt;
	In Part I and II of this contribution 42 taxa of the genus &lt;em&gt;Antheraea &lt;/em&gt;were examined by us to receive a good overview on the morphological structures of the wing venation in &lt;em&gt;Antheraea&lt;/em&gt;. Aberrations were observed at two taxa (three wings). As already noted by Toxopeus (1940), the lengths of R1+2 (sensu Paukstadt &amp;amp; Paukstadt 2018) [= R1 sensu Toxopeus 1940] are different in various taxa and therefore arise at the stalk of vein R in different positions. The taxa are grouped according to their morphology of the wing venation, regardless of color, pattern and/or genital morphological or other differences.
